Map
Detailed Information
- Place Types Transit station
- Address Norwich, VT 05055, USA
- Coordinate 43.7053795,-72.3095093
- Website Unknown
- Rating Unknown
- Compound Code PM4R+55 Norwich, VT, USA
Reviews
Similar place